Transaction 703e113872d28934251b69fd5604d958d0dbcf407ab4ce26c1b763b88e44610e

34 Input
2 Outputs
  • 703e113872d28934251b69fd5604d958d0dbcf407ab4ce26c1b763b88e44610e:0
  • value  886655594
    address  3LmFGLSNJwPi2b468EH6wemv3GgEvC89Dk
  • 703e113872d28934251b69fd5604d958d0dbcf407ab4ce26c1b763b88e44610e:1
  • value  922273
    address  38XZtJ3AztLbAUvkRWDpPTpJ5uPJVWXoGZ